Characteristics of youth and susceptibility to peer pressure
The purpose of this chapter is to review the contribution of adolescents’ individual characteristics in explanation of susceptibility to peer pressure. Taken together, current findings suggest that boys and girls who are more susceptible to peer pressure show higher levels of emotional problems, e.g. anxiety and depression. As a result, they have more difficulties developing healthy secure relationships with others, which in turn leads to higher social anxiety (i.e. fear of rejection and abandonment) in peer relations, and lower global self-worth.
